Pelicans’ Jaxson Hayes Receives Probation, Community Service Sentence

Pelicans center Jaxson Hayes to three years probation for a scuffle with police in Los Angeles in February 2021, the Associated Press reported.Jaxson Hayes

At the time of Hayes arrest, officers were responding to a domestic disturbance call at his home.

Along with having to serve probation, Hayes was sentenced to 450 hours of community service and a year of weekly classes on domestic violence. While the incident occurred in LA, Hayes will be permitted be fulfill his community service obligations in New Orleans (or wherever he is playing should he be traded).

Per the AP report:

“Police body camera video showed Hayes scuffling with officers and being hit twice with an electronic stun gun after they ordered him out of the home while they sought to question a woman inside.

Hayes told officers the woman was his girlfriend and that she had been “throwing some stuff” at him while they argued.

Hayes was treated at a hospital after the altercation. An officer thrown against a wall by Hayes was treated for an elbow injury.”

Hayes, 22, appeared in 70 games with the Pelicans last season, averaging 9.3 points and 4.5 rebounds, mostly off the bench.
